Death does not concern us
â
Death does not concern us, because as long as we exist, death is not here. And when it does come, we no longer exist.
â
Meaning
This quote means death should not trouble us in the same way we fear other things, because we never experience it at the same moment we exist. It offers a philosophical way to reduce fear of dying.
